Record-Journal

The Record-Journal is a local print and digital daily newspaper based in Meriden, Connecticut, covering local news, sports and community news in the Central Connecticut area. Dating back to the years immediately following the American Civil War, it is owned by the Record-Journal Publishing Company, a family-owned business entity that also owns Westerly, Rhode Island's The Westerly Sun. Centro de Periodismo Investigativo

The Centro de Periodismo Investigativo is a nonprofit that produces in-depth investigative journalism, published in both Spanish and English, and distributes its content free of charge to readers and media outlets in Puerto Rico and abroad. The CPI has won recognition producing stories on corruption, cronyism in government, electoral campaigns, and public policy in health, education, the economy and the environment. Its work has proven to be crucial and in some instances pivotal in bringing about social change, accountability, recovery and justice.

KUNR Public Radio

KUNR Public Radio, an NPR affiliate and news site, covers the Reno-Sparks metro area, several rural towns across northern Nevada and a handful of California cities near Lake Tahoe. As an early adopter of Spanish-language digital content, KUNR is addressing language-access gaps in the community. KUNR is a member station of the Mountain West News Bureau, a collaborative of several public radio stations that cover Western issues.
